Cardano founder declares ecosystem ready to thrive without him

Cardano founder declares ecosystem ready to thrive without him

GrafaGrafa2025/04/14 21:00
By:Mahathir Bayena

Charles Hoskinson, founder of Cardano (CRYPTO:ADA), said on April 12 that the blockchain ecosystem has reached full decentralisation, hinting at a reduced role for himself as he embarks on a risky personal journey.

“This time it’s to go somewhere to do something that is quite dangerous—so much so there is a possibility of death,” Hoskinson said in a livestream titled “See you on the other side,” as he reflected on more than ten years of building Cardano

He noted the address was a precaution in case the expedition, which he has been planning for a year, does not end safely.

At the core of Hoskinson’s message was the announcement that Cardano’s governance is now fully decentralised.

He credited this milestone to the Voltaire framework, under which the project’s constitution has been ratified both at a constitutional convention and through on-chain voting.

“There are almost a thousand DREs [Delegated Representative Entities] registered and an interesting distribution of power amongst them,” Hoskinson said.

He emphasised that power has transitioned from the founding bodies to the community, with a transitional constitutional committee now in place and full democratic elections planned later this year.

Budget reconciliation among DRAPs (Delegated Representative Action Plans) is expected to conclude within two to three months.

“I wanted to build something where I could spend my entire life working on it, but I didn’t want to be a dictator or a king,” he said, comparing his decision to step back to Satoshi Nakamoto’s departure from Bitcoin.

Hoskinson also highlighted Cardano’s growing technical plurality, noting multiple independent node implementations are now being developed by teams like Pragma, TXPipe, Blink Labs, and Harmonic.

The Paris workshop he attended also included Ethereum community members, signaling interest in client diversity and cross-chain collaboration.

While Input Output Global will remain involved in the ecosystem, Hoskinson stated that the community now has control over how central its role will be going forward.

He also mentioned growing interest in Midnight, a privacy-focused protocol within Cardano, which may serve as a gateway for users across multiple blockchains.
